    That must be so difficult Rachel..

    is it possible a member of staff could set up facetime when your mom visits and both of you could be "visiting" together? Or could you give them your mobile/tablet for them to video him each time so you have the latest pictures?

    It might also be comforting for him if he's unable to communicate himself, to hear your voice so again think about recording a message for him and vice versa if possible.

    Try to think of a way to use tech to your advantage, especially photos and videos. Not the same as being there in person I know, but it can be the closest thing and a precious memento.

    Ask the staff what other families have come up with.
